The Bangalore rajakaluve map provides a detailed overview of the city’s storm water drainage network. These drains form an interconnected system that carries rainwater from urban areas toward lakes and reservoirs, helping reduce waterlogging.
The rajakaluve map Bangalore categorizes drainage channels into primary, secondary, and tertiary types. Primary drains handle large volumes of water, while secondary and tertiary drains manage water flow within residential neighborhoods.
Each drainage channel is surrounded by a buffer zone where construction is restricted. These zones ensure proper water flow and protect the drainage system. By reviewing the Bangalore rajakaluve map, buyers can confirm whether a property is located in a safe and permissible area.
The cdp plan Bangalore 2031 serves as the official framework for land use and zoning in the city. It ensures that urban development follows a structured approach and supports sustainable growth.
The cdp plan Bangalore 2031 divides land into various categories such as residential, commercial, industrial, mixed use, and green belt areas. Each category has specific regulations that determine what type of construction is allowed.
Before purchasing property, buyers should verify zoning regulations using the cdp plan Bangalore 2031. Combining zoning insights with the rajakaluve map Bangalore helps buyers make informed decisions that align with both regulatory and environmental requirements.
A structured property buying checklist is essential for ensuring that buyers complete all necessary verifications before finalizing a property purchase. In Bangalore’s competitive real estate market, this step helps reduce risks and improves decision making.
The first step in a property buying checklist is verifying ownership documents and confirming that the seller has legal authority to transfer the property. Buyers should also check the encumbrance certificate to ensure there are no financial liabilities.
Another key step is evaluating zoning and environmental compliance. Buyers should verify zoning through the cdp plan Bangalore 2031 and review drainage alignment using the rajakaluve map Bangalore. Following a reliable property buying checklist ensures a safe and informed transaction.
